While pro-establishment crowds celebrate Khamenei's appointment as his father's successor, others believe it signals no change to how Iran is ruled.

Iran's clerical leadership chose confrontation over compromise in appointing Mojtaba Khamenei to succeed his father.

Many expect the 56-year-old, who has largely kept a low profile, to continue his father's hardline policies.

Mojtaba Khamenei is to replace his father as Iran’s new supreme leader
